I don't think the wheelbase influences the turning radius a lot unless you do sharp turns at slow speeds; at normal speeds the front and rear wheel are generally in plane. 272 mm is not a low BB height I'd say.

FYI, by shortening the fork 15 mm you have increased the angles by ~1 degree, besides reducing the BB height.
